Abstract
OBJECTIVE: To review sperm DNA fragmentation (SDF) testing as an important sperm function test in addition to conventional semen analysis. High SDF is negatively associated with semen quality, the fertilisation process, embryo quality, and pregnancy outcome. Over recent decades, different SDF assays have been developed and reviewed extensively to assess their applicability and accuracy as advanced sperm function tests. Amongst them, the standardisation of the terminal deoxynucleotidyl transferased UTP nick-end labelling (TUNEL) assay with a bench top flow cytometer in clinical practice deserves special mention with a threshold value of 16.8% to differentiate infertile men with DNA damage from fertile men.Entities:

Associated factors and effect of high SDF on ART outcomes.
| Factors contributing to increased SDF | Impact of high SDF on ART outcomes |
|---|---|
High degree SDF despite having normal semen parameters Positive correlation with age %DFI higher in men aged ≥40 years Positive association exists between varicocele and SDF High SDF in both fertile and infertile men with varicocele Impaired spermatogenesis and fertility Radiotherapy increased SDF and chemotherapy lowered SDF Radioiodine therapy for thyroid cancer increased DFI Oxidative stress positive correlated with SDF High SDF even in low levels of leucocytospermia Poor spermatogenesis High SDF in workers exposed to pesticides and ionising radiations Bisphenol-A exposure leads to high SDF Smoking has negative impact on sperm DNA integrity Excessive alcohol consumption increases SDF | Very low conception rates Low pregnancy rate (odds ratio 9.9) Pregnancy loss with SDF >12% Negatively correlated with SDF Fair to poor predictive value of different SDF assays for prediction of pregnancy SDF ≥22.3% had significantly lower fertilisation rates with ICSI Negative impact on reduced cleavage Negative association with live-birth rate after IVF Increased live-birth rate with low SDF High miscarriage rates and recurrent spontaneous abortion after IVF and ICSI |
